**Wiki: PointsLedger Environment Variables** Reviewer note: PointsLedger reads all runtime config from its `.env` file at boot; nothing is hardcoded. `LEDGER_DB_URL` and `LEDGER_FLUSH_INTERVAL` are non-sensitive and checked into the sample file. The signing credential used to authorize balance adjustments is not, and must be added locally by each developer. For a working local setup, the env file must contain this line:

env line for fafof-fahag: LEDGER_TOKEN5=f8790

# RouteSmith environments

RouteSmith's driver-assignment heuristic runs in three environments: dev, staging, and prod. Dev uses synthetic trip data, so don't panic if assignments look weird there — that's expected. Staging mirrors prod traffic at 10%, which is where you should reproduce incidents first. Prod changes need sign-off from the dispatch platform team. Each environment boots with its own settings; prod currently runs with the following.

config for bahop-fajep:
DRUATH_PIN=4501
DRUATH_TENANT=briwyn
DRUATH_METRICS_HOST=metrics.druath.brasksoft.test
DRUATH_SEAL=seal_7d2e069d
DRUATH_STANDBY_TEAM=olieth

Action item from the Mirewater tide-table widget incident. Owner: release manager. Widget cached stale harbor offsets after the DST change, showing tides six hours off for two days. Required: add a cache-invalidation check to the release checklist, block deploys when offset tables are older than 24 hours, and verify the Saltgate harbor feed before each cut. Deadline: next release. Checklist template and sign-off procedure are documented on the internal page below.

wiki page, kawif-bajep: https://artifactory.zarqelforge.internal/issue/browse/display/display/projects/spaces/secrets/000fe6ec5a46af29355003e1

**Ticket QX-2291 — Formula sandbox escapes via nested lambdas**

Plugin authors: user-supplied formulas in Gridwell must run inside the Tessera sandbox. We found nested lambdas can reach the host evaluator and bypass quota checks. Until the patched runtime ships, reject formulas deeper than three levels. When filing repros, include the sandbox trace token shown below.

session token of tajef-bageg = htk21_5d90d574934f3ccae6437